6. Create a Mindfulness Jar: A Visual Touchstone
Have you ever heard of a mindfulness jar? It can serve as an unexpected but effective way to ground your thoughts. To create one, simply take an empty jar and fill it with slips of paper containing meaningful notes, quotes, or lessons that inspire you. Whenever life’s chaos leaves you feeling scattered, just a glance inside the jar can reignite your focus on your core values and aspirations.
I’ve made it a habit to add new notes weekly—some are motivational quotes, while others recount valuable lessons I’ve learned. One morning, when I felt particularly anxious, I reached for a note that read, “Breathe; you’re doing wonderfully.” That moment brought me back to clarity, reinforcing that mindfulness is as much about the journey as it is the destination.
- Select a jar and decorate it in ways that resonate with you.
- Aim to add at least one new note each day.
- Consult your jar whenever you need a mental boost.
Having this physical reminder becomes a comforting tool, encouraging continuous reflection and mindfulness in my everyday life.

FAQs
What is mindfulness? Mindfulness involves being fully present in the moment, aware of your thoughts and feelings without judgment.
How can I start practicing mindfulness? Begin with straightforward techniques like mindful breathing or journaling, and discover which methods resonate most with you.
Can mindfulness help reduce stress? Yes, numerous studies suggest that mindfulness practices can decrease stress and enhance emotional well-being.
How often should I practice mindfulness? Consistency matters more than frequency. Aim to weave mindfulness into your daily routine, even if just for a few minutes.
